Mastering Hunter Pro Spray Nozzle Adjustments

Fine-tuning your Hunter Pro spray nozzles is crucial for achieving optimal watering efficiency. These nozzles provide a range of adjustable configurations, allowing you to customize water distribution for different lawn and garden requirements.

Understanding the effect of adjusting these settings will significantly optimize your irrigation system's effectiveness. Begin by identifying the optimal nozzle for your specific application.

Factors like head type, flow rate, and watering range will guide your determination.

Once you've chosen the appropriate nozzle, tweak its settings to meet your watering requirements.

A few key modifications include:

* Radius/Spread:

Controls the distance water travels.

* Pattern Type:

Dictates the spray configuration.

* Arc Angle:

Sets the watering arc width.

By meticulously adjusting these parameters, you can create a uniform and efficient watering pattern for your lawn and garden. Remember to evaluate your adjustments regularly to ensure optimal performance and water conservation.

Addressing Common Hunter Pro Spray Nozzle Issues

When your Hunter Pro spray nozzle fails to operate properly, it can be frustrating. Don't panic! Several common issues can easily be sorted out. Here are some tips to assist in identifying the problem:

* **Check for Clogs:** Spray nozzles can click here suffocate with debris, like dirt or sediment. Carefully examine the nozzle's tip and dislodge any impediment using a wire.

* **Adjust Nozzle Pressure:** The pressure setting on your Hunter Pro can influence the spray pattern. Consult the instructions for your specific model to adjust the nozzle's pressure to ensure a proper coverage area.

* **Ensure Proper Nozzle Placement:** The placement of your spray nozzles can drastically affect their performance. Make sure they are correctly positioned and pointing in the desired direction.
